About Us

 

Zeager began doing business in 1967 as a family-owned saw mill manufacturing various products for the wood industry. By the late 70’s Zeager was the first to produce a product called engineered wood fiber which by the mid 80’s became an excepted surfacing for playgrounds because of the high impact attenuating properties and natural look. In recent years, Zeager participated with the U.S.D.A. Forest Products Research Lab in their development of a stabilized engineered wood fiber, which we now offer as Bonded WoodCarpet. Their research was a direct result of the U.S. Access Board’s desire to improve the accessibility of engineered wood fiber, which was recognized as one of the more commonly used playground surfaces. Today we offer a full range of playground surfaces, both unitary and loose-fill, that meet ADA, ASTM, CPSC and CSA standards. Our surfaces are third party certified and have been lab and field tested under a variety of climate conditions.
